TOEFL – Test of English as a Foreign Language
The minimum score on the TOEFL IBT (internet-based testing) required for admission to
IUBH School of Business and Management is 80 of 120 possible points. Your TOEFL score
must be submitted before you start your studies and must not be older than two years
when you start your studies. You must submit an original copy of your “TOEFL Score Re-
port”.
The test has four parts:
Listening: 60 - 100 minutes
Reading: 60 - 90 minutes
Writing: 50 minutes
Speaking: 20 minutes

IELTS – International English Language
The minimum score on the IELTS-Test (academic version) required for admission to IUBH
School of Business and Management is 6.0 points from a maximum of 9.0 possible points.
Your IELTS results must be submitted before you start your studies and must not be older
than two years when you start your studies. You must submit an original copy of your
“IELTS Score Report”.
The test has four parts:
Listening: 30 minutes
Reading: 60 minutes
Writing: 60 minutes
Speaking: 15 minutes

Cambridge Certificates ESOL –
English for Speakers of Other Languages
CAE – Cambridge Certificate in Advanced English
The minimum grade on the CAE required for admission to IUBH School of Business and
Management is a “B grade overall”. Your CAE results must be submitted before you start
your studies and must not be older than two years when you start your studies. You must
submit an original copy of your CAE Score Report.
The test has five parts, each part counts for 20% of the final grade:
Reading: 75 minutes
Writing: 90 minutes
Use of English: 60 minutes
Listening: 40 minutes
Speaking: 15 minutes

CPE – Certificate of Proficiency in English
The minimum grade on CPE test required for admission to IUBH School of Business and
Management is a “C grade overall“. Your CPE results must be submitted before you start
your studies and must not be older than two years when you start your studies. You must
submit an original copy of your “CPE Score Report“.
The test has four parts:
Reading and Use of English: 90 minutes
Writing: 90 minutes
Listening: 40 minutes
Speaking : 16 minutes, the oral examination is taken together with
one or two other candidates and conducted by two examiners.

BEC Higher – Business English Certificate
Passing the BEC Higher examination also qualifies you to study at IUBH School of Business
and Management. The test certifies proficiency in business English at the upper intermedi-
ate level. Your BEC Higher results must be submitted before you start your studies and
must not be older than two years when you start your studies. You must submit an original
copy of your “BEC Higher Report”.
The examination has four parts, each part counts for 25% of the final grade:
Reading: 60 minutes
Writing: 70 minutes
Listening: – 40 minutes
Speaking: – 16 minutes

PTE – Pearson Test of English
The minimum score on the PTE required for admission to IUBH School of Business and
Management is 56 out of 100 points, with a minimum of 51 points required in each of the
three parts. Your PTE results must be submitted before you start your studies and must not
be older than two years when you start your studies. You must submit an original of your
“PTE Score Report”.
The test has three parts:
Part 1: Speaking & Writing (77 – 93 minutes)
Part 2: Reading (32 – 41 minutes)
Part 3: Listening (45 – 57 minutes)
There are 2 PET-Test-Centres in Germany. One centre is in Berlin, the other is in Frankfurt.
